From Traditional to Digital: The Evolution of Surveying in Bangladesh
Surveying across Bangladesh has undergone a remarkable evolution from age-old methods to contemporary digital technologies. Early surveyors utilized on instruments like theodolite and compass, painstakingly calculating distances and angles manually.
Nevertheless, the emergence of Global Positioning System (GPS) and other digital tools has disrupted the field. Currently, surveyors utilize sophisticated software and hardware to obtain accurate spatial data, enhancing efficiency and detail. This change has impacted various sectors, from construction and infrastructure development to urban planning and resource management.
